WebAgainst this ego-politics of knowledge he proposes a "body-politics of knowing/ sensing/ understanding", grounded in an understanding of the place from which knowledge proceeds [Mignolo 2013: 132]. In conversation, he talks of linked processes of "reasoning" and "emotioning" [Mignolo pers. comm. 2015, Shepherd and Ernsten 2016]. WebThe egopolitics of knowledge of Rene Descartes in the 17th century, where Western men replace God as the foundation of knowledge, is the foundational basis of modern Western philosophy.

WebMay 14, 2007 · This contrasts with the European-based “Theo-” and “Ego-” politics of knowledge that systematically devalue what Mignolo (2006) terms the “Geo-” and “Bio-” graphic politics of knowledge that emphasize epistemological “rules” grounded in the history of political imperialism as differentially experienced around the world.
